    Abstract: An information processing apparatus includes a storage device, an arithmetic processing unit, a first converting device, and a second converting device. The storage device outputs data in accordance with a memory access request. The arithmetic processing unit performs an arithmetic operation on the data. The first converting device converts a memory access request issued by the arithmetic processing unit to a memory access signal and sends to the storage device. The second converting device converts a memory access request issued by the arithmetic processing unit to a memory access signal, acquires the memory access signal sent by the first converting device, and compares the content of a memory access performed by using the converted memory access signal with the content of a memory access performed by using the acquired memory access signal, and determines whether the first converting device has failed.

    Abstract: An imaging system includes a first detection sensor configured to detect an imaging target area by the imaging system as a detection target and a second detection sensor configured to detect any portion of a path to the imaging target area as a detection target. The imaging system further includes a processor which performs imaging control by using a condition that a time interval when detection is not performed by the second detection sensor is a predetermined time interval or more and detection is performed by the first detection sensor as an acquisition condition for a captured image of the imaging target area.

    Abstract: A colony image inspection device (10) acquires each of captured images of three or more petri dishes in each of which the same type of bacterial colony is cultured to be inspected. Furthermore, the colony image inspection device (10) calculates a similarity among the acquired three or more images. Furthermore, the colony image inspection device (10) selects two images indicating that the similarity is the lowest from among the three or more images. Furthermore, the colony image inspection device (10) outputs the selected two images as images that are arranged side by side.

    Abstract: A non-transitory computer-readable recording medium stores a colony inspection program that causes a computer to execute a process. The process includes: acquiring each of captured images of a plurality of petri dishes in each of which bacterial colonies are included; calculating similarity between the plurality of the images; and changing, based on the calculated similarity, whether an alarm is output.

    Abstract: A non-transitory computer-readable recording medium stores a colony examination program that causes a computer to execute a process. The process includes: obtaining, for each of a plurality of specimens from which colonies of bacteria are cultured, a piece of information used for identifying the specimen; arranging the pieces of information identifying the specimens, based on a time period a product represented by each of the specimens takes to arrive at a shipment delivery destination from a facility that produced the specimen, the time period being indicated in each of the obtained pieces of information identifying the specimens; and displaying the arranged pieces of information identifying the specimens, in a list.

    Abstract: An information processing apparatus includes a switch unit configured to connect some of the arithmetic processing devices and some of the storage devices in accordance with connection information, a first control unit being configured to output physical information converted from the logical information of the arithmetic processing device at the transmission destination and the physical information of the corresponding arithmetic processing device via a transfer path in accordance with the correlation information, a second control unit configured to change the connection information in response to occurrence of a failure of some arithmetic processing device in the system, and to control the switch unit such that the failed arithmetic processing device is replaced with another one included in the plural arithmetic processing devices.

    Abstract: An apparatus, which is for disaster prevention installed in a facility, includes a radio-frequency identification tag that stores at least one of a first data and a second data. The first data is related to the disaster prevention, and is transmitted by wireless communication. The second data is related to the disaster prevention, and is received by wireless communication.
